Output c161377cb25baf17ca2bf6c8a1ef036fadcec2d9fc60e55cf0640b0cff1f3050:18

value
1394637406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88791cb1d7bd29da4a48abd60155fd8b3db93389 OP_EQUAL
address
3E8cueYarTZz1huDXWvAdRY796uWJ9co5V
transaction
c161377cb25baf17ca2bf6c8a1ef036fadcec2d9fc60e55cf0640b0cff1f3050
confirmations
390499
spent
true